AFTERNOON NEWSCASTER/PRODUCER  
 
KERA, the public media organization for North Texas, is hiring an Afternoon Newscaster/Producer to take over one of our station’s most visible and influential radio on-air roles.


WHO WE ARE: 
Serving the country’s fourth-largest media market, KERA reaches more than 5 million people monthly through KERA TV, KERA News, KXT, WRR and The Denton Record-Chronicle. For more than 65 years, North Texans have turned to KERA as a destination for community engagement and lifelong learning.

As we seek to recognize and reflect our audience and communities, we encourage applicants from all backgrounds and points of view to consider employment opportunities at KERA.


POSITION SUMMARY:
The Afternoon Newscaster/Producer plays a critical role in planning, producing and delivering reliable, in-the-moment news to KERA’s audiences each afternoon.

The ideal candidate works rapidly under tight deadlines to produce accurate reporting both collaboratively with staff and independently, with a conversational but professional on-air delivery. This person is a strong producer with excellent news judgement and the ability to quickly write, edit and deliver news copy over the airwaves and on our digital platforms to reach a dynamic and diverse community.

This position is an FLSA classified non-exempt position, is eligible for overtime, and reports directly to the Managing Editor, KERA News
